American names, fake QuickBooks badges, and Rs 40 crore: How 2 Bengaluru techies ran a shadow tax empire

Karnataka police have arrested two software engineers for operating a fake call center that defrauded US citizens of Rs 40 crore. The duo, posing as QuickBooks technical support, offered tax advice and services, tricking victims into transferring money. Investigations revealed the use of fake notices and shell companies to facilitate the fraud.
